do not have to memorize it. just understand it.
All problems in fixed income/derivatives are just discounting and compounding.
what you need to do is idetify are :
which point of time do you have to discount to
which discount rate you should use
which value(future? present?) you should use
the rest is just multiple a (1+x)^t, or divide by it.作者: lucasg85 时间: 2011-7-11 19:28
I ignore the value formula and base everything on the price formula, which is easy: take the long rate divide it by the short rate, then minus one, then annualize it. Done. The value of the FRA is basically a difference between two prices, calculated as above.
